A Poem by Ashwin Shanker
"

Time for the muse to guide the artist

"

Stop staring at the blank paper,

I am right here.

Draw the first few strokes already,

There is no need to fear.

 

Start with my face, the oval outline,

C’mon, go ahead you will get it right.

You might have to curve it up a little,

When you continue along my right.

 

I see that you are looking down my neck now,

Get the creases of my shirt right,

Baby, it’s in the details,

C’mon, go ahead you will get it right.

 

Now, get a good look at my lips,

Am I smiling at you? Are you sure?

Am I nice, am I sour?

Do you think my lips have an allure?

 

We now look at each other eye to eye.

And your fingers pause for a bit, you are perspiring.

You better get this right the first time, no second try.

From my pupil to my iris, Baby it’s in the details,

But I am with you, C’mon, go ahead you will get it right.

 

I see your pencil sliding flat strokes along the sides,

Let each of your strokes do justice to my lush hair.

Baby, it’s in the details; I see your touches with care.

 

I want me to come out through you.

I want my expression to be expressed well.

I want my eyes to shine, my lips should tell.

That the best man to sketch the face; is you.
